Man shoots friend over N1,000 debt in Anambra

A 27-year-old man identified as Friday Asuquo has been arrested by the Special Anti-Robbery Squad of the Anambra state police command for allegedly shooting his friend, Kingsley Araino, over N1, 000 debt on Friday, July 17.

This was contained in a statement released by the Police Public Relations Officer in the state, Mohammed Haruna.

According to the PPRO, the suspect who hails from Cross Rivers state but resides at Enu-Orji village in Amawbia, used a pump-action he got from the City of Restoration Church in Amawbia to shoot Kingsley when they had an argument over N1,000.

“Following the altercation, the suspect quickly rushed inside one City of Restoration Church, Amawbia, brought out a pump action gun loaded with four live cartridges, and allegedly shot the victim at his back. The scene of the incident was visited by the police detectives, and the victim rushed to Amaku General Hospital, Awka, for medical attention. He is responding to treatment.” the statement read

Mohammed said the pump-action used in perpetrating the crime, three live cartridges and one expended cartridge were recovered as exhibits.

The police spokesman added that the suspect had confessed to the crime and an investigation is ongoing after which he would be arraigned in court.
